Understanding the Error
The "Machine Tipw and Serial Number Invalid" error typically indicates a mismatch between the software/hardware and the provided serial key. This could stem from several issues, including:
- Incorrect Serial Number Entry: Typos are surprisingly common. Double-check for any errors in the serial number, paying close attention to upper/lowercase letters and numbers.
- Expired Serial Number: Some serial numbers have expiration dates. Verify your serial number's validity with the software vendor.
- Software Piracy: Using cracked or illegally obtained software often leads to this error. Purchase legitimate software for a seamless experience.
- Software Corruption: Damaged software files can sometimes cause conflicts. Reinstalling the software can solve this.
- Hardware Issues: In some cases, hardware problems might interfere with the software's verification process. Check for any hardware malfunctions.
- Conflicting Software: Other programs might clash with the software. Try temporarily disabling other applications.
- Registry Errors: Problems with the Windows registry can also lead to this error. This requires careful registry cleaning (proceed with caution).
Troubleshooting Steps
Let's delve into step-by-step solutions:
1. Verify Serial Number Accuracy:
- Carefully compare your serial number with the one on your product key.
- Use a text editor to copy and paste to eliminate typing errors.
- Check for any extra spaces or characters.
2. Check for Expiration Date:
- Contact the software vendor or check the product documentation for the expiry date of your serial number.
3. Reinstall the Software:
- Completely uninstall the software using the control panel.
- Download a fresh copy of the software from the official website.
- Install the fresh copy and enter the serial number again.
4. Update Software:
- Often, software updates resolve minor bugs and compatibility issues.
- Check for and install any available updates for the software.
5. Run System File Checker (SFC):
- Open command prompt as administrator and type
sfc /scannow
. - This tool will scan for and repair system file corruption.
6. Contact Technical Support:
- If none of these steps resolve the issue, seek help from the software provider's technical support team. They'll have specific tools and solutions for the software in question.
7. Check Hardware:
- Ensure all hardware components connected to your computer are working correctly.
- Test your hardware using system diagnostic tools.
8. Consider System Restore:
- Restore your system to a previous point in time before the problem started.
